body {
	background-color: #FF3334;
	background-image: url(/images/corner_red.gif);
}

/* Begin calendar styles*/
.calendar th { color: #7D8A75;
}
.calendar th a, .articlebody a { color: #67C828;
}
.calendar td { 
	color: #7D8A75;
	background: url(/images/bg_cal_red.gif) 0px 0px no-repeat;
}
.calendar td a { color: #67C828;
}
.calendar td a:hover {
	background: url(/images/bg_cal_red.gif) -2px -27px no-repeat;
}
.calendar_box, .sidecontent form input { border: 1px solid #7D8A75;
}
td.today {
	background: url(/images/bg_cal_red.gif) 0px -50px no-repeat;
}
/* End calendar styles*/

/* Begin sidebar styles*/
.sidebar-2, .sidebar-3 {
	background: url(/images/sidebar_bg_top_red.gif) 0px 0px no-repeat;
}
.sidebarbg {
	background: url(/images/sidebar_bg_bot_red.gif) bottom left no-repeat;
}
.sidebarbg li {
	background: url(/images/bullet_red.gif) 1px 6px no-repeat;
}
.sidecontent, .sidecontent_email {
	background: url(/images/sidebar_bg_mid_red.gif) 0px 0px repeat-y;
}
#sidelinks h4 {
	color: #67C828;
	border-bottom: 1px dashed #7D8A75;
}
h5.cathead, h5.archivehead {
	color: #67C828;
	border-bottom: 1px dashed #7D8A75;
}
#sidelinks p, .sidebar-3 p { color: #67C828; 
}
#sidelinks a:hover {
	border-bottom: 1px dashed #67C828;
}
/* End sidebar styles*/

h2 { color: #8A7575;
}
h3, h3 a { color: #8A7575;
}

/* Begin top navigation styles*/
#nav {
	background: url(/images/red_nav.gif) 0px 0px no-repeat;
}
#nav a {
	height: 30px;
  display: block;
}
#news a:hover {
	background: url(/images/red_nav.gif) transparent 0px -63px no-repeat;
}
#stand-up a:hover {
	background: url(/images/red_nav.gif) transparent -82px -63px no-repeat;
}
#sketch-improv a:hover {
	background: url(/images/red_nav.gif) transparent -228px -63px no-repeat;
}
#podcast a:hover {
	background: url(/images/red_nav.gif) transparent -458px -63px no-repeat;
}
#photos a:hover {
	background: url(/images/red_nav.gif) transparent -597px -63px no-repeat;
}
#resume a:hover {
	background: url(/images/red_nav.gif) transparent -7px -95px no-repeat;
}
#bio a:hover {
	background: url(/images/red_nav.gif) transparent -137px -95px no-repeat;
}
#fan-art a:hover {
	background: url(/images/red_nav.gif) transparent -197px -95px no-repeat;
}
#merchandise  a:hover {
	background: url(/images/red_nav.gif) transparent -316px -95px no-repeat;
}
#links  a:hover {
	background: url(/images/red_nav.gif) transparent -528px -95px no-repeat;
}
#contact  a:hover {
	background: url(/images/red_nav.gif) transparent -616px -95px no-repeat;
}
/* End top navigation styles*/

/* Begin main content styles*/
#header {
	background: url(/images/eggetext_red.gif) 44px 1px no-repeat #ffffff;
}
/*#divider {
  background: url(/images/divider_red.gif) repeat-x scroll top left;
}*/
#divider {
  background: url(/images/divider_red_wide.gif) no-repeat scroll top left;
}
#container {
  background: url(/images/content_bg_top_red.gif) 0px 0px no-repeat;
}
#content {
  background: url(/images/content_bg_mid_red.gif) 0px 20px repeat-y;
}
.commentlist h5 {
	background: url(/images/comment_red.gif) 0px 0px no-repeat;
}
#foot {
  background: url(/images/content_bg_bot_red.gif) top left no-repeat;
}
#sectionhead {
	background: url(/images/sectionhead_whatsnew_red.gif) top left no-repeat;
}
#sectionhead_standup {
	width: 175px;
	right: 470px;
	top: -30px;
	background: url(/images/sectionhead_standup.gif) top left no-repeat;
}
.date {
	border-top: 1px #67C828 dashed;
}
.commentinvite a { color: #FF9933;
}
.commentinvite a:hover {
	border-bottom: 1px #67C828 dashed;
}
.forward a {
	background: url(/images/next_red.gif) 0px 0px no-repeat;
}
.back a {
	background: url(/images/last_red.gif) 0px 0px no-repeat;
}
.forward a:hover {
	background: url(/images/next_red.gif) 0px -20px no-repeat;
}
.back a:hover {
	background: url(/images/last_red.gif) 0px -20px no-repeat;
}
.backtogigs h4 {
	font-weight: normal;
	color: #2895C9;
	font: 13px "Century Gothic", Arial, Verdana, sans-serif;
	margin-left: 10px;
	margin-top: 0px;
	text-align: right;
	border-top: 1px dashed #FF9433;
}
div.articletext {
	border-top: 1px dashed #FF9433;
}
/* End main content styles*/

/* Begin upcoming gigs styles*/
.upcoming {
	font: 12px "Century Gothic", Arial, Verdana, sans-serif;
	text-align: left;
	padding: 5px 0px 0px 0px;
}
.events {
	padding: 56px 0px 0px 0px;
	background: url(/images/standup_green.gif) 0px 0px no-repeat;
}
.day {
	float: left;
	font-weight: bold;
	width: 39px;
	margin: 0px; padding: 0px 0px 0px 1px;
}
.eventdate {
	float: left;
	font-weight: bold;
	width: 49px;
	margin: 0px; padding: 0;
}
.time {
	float: left;
	width: 45px;
	margin: 0px; padding: 0px;
}
.venue {
	float: left;
	width: 80px;
	margin: 0px; padding: 0px;
}
.location {
	float: left;
	width: 150px;
	margin: 0px; padding: 0px;
}
.moreinfo {
	float: left;
	margin: 0px; padding: 3px 0px 0px 20px;
}
.moreinfo a {
	display:block;
	width: 14px;
	line-height: 20px;
	text-indent:-100.0em;
	text-decoration:none;
	background: url(/images/ques.gif) 0px 0px no-repeat;
}
.moreinfo a:hover {
	background: url(/images/ques.gif) 0px -20px no-repeat;
}
/* End upcoming gigs styles*/

/* Begin Comment display styles*/
.commentdisplay {
	border-top: 1px #67C828 dashed;
}
.commentdisplay a { color: #FF9933;
}
.commentdisplay a:hover { color:  #FFE933;
}
.comment_name_input, .comment_web_input, .comment_email_input, #Name, #Email {
	background: transparent url(/images/form_box_red.gif) 0px 0px no-repeat;
}
textarea.txpCommentInputMessage {
	background: transparent url(/images/textarea_red.gif) 0px 0px no-repeat fixed;
}
span>textarea.txpCommentInputMessage {
	background: transparent url(/images/form_box_textarea.gif) 0px 0px no-repeat;
}
textarea#Message {
	background: transparent url(/images/form_box_textarea.gif) 0px 0px no-repeat;
}
#cmntform h5 {
	background: url(/images/comment_q_red.gif) 0px 0px no-repeat;
}
input.button, input.contact_button, button.button {
	border: 1px solid #8A7575;
	background-color: #D0C8C8;
}
.events a {
	color: #2895C9;
}
#sectionlink_standup {
	float: left;
	display: inline;
	text-indent: -9000px;
}
#sectionlink_standup a {
	height: 55px;
	width: 175px;
	display: block;
}
#foottext {
	color: #fff;
}